GFI1 (Growth factor independent protein 1) is a nuclear zinc finger protein that functions as a transcriptional repressor. This protein plays a role in diverse developmental contexts, including hematopoiesis and oncogenesis. It functions as part of a complex along with other cofactors to control histone modifications that lead to silencing of the target gene promoters.

KLF4 (Krueppel-like factor 4) is a transcription factor, can act both as activator and as repressor. KLF4 binds the 5'-CACCC-3' core sequence of promoters, and also binds to its own promoter region of its own gene and can activate its own transcription. KLF4 regulates the expression of key transcription factors during embryonic development. KLF4 plays an important role in maintaining embryonic stem cells, in preventing their differentiation. POU5F1/OCT4, SOX2, MYC/c-Myc and KLF4 are the four Yamanaka factors.

SMAD6 (Mothers against decapentaplegic homolog 6) protein is an antagonist of signaling by TGF-beta type 1 receptor superfamily members. It has been shown to inhibit selectively BMP (bone morphogenetic proteins) signaling by competing with the co-SMAD SMAD4 for receptor-activated SMAD1. SMAD6 is an inhibitory SMAD (I-SMAD) or antagonistic SMAD. Binds to regulatory elements in target promoter regions. SMAD6 is ubiquitous in various organs, with higher levels in lung. Isoform B is up-regulated in diseased heart tissue.

GATA1 (GATA-binding factor 1) is a member of the GATA family of zinc-finger transcription factors. GATA1 is an erythroid specific transcription factor, GATA sequence binding protein (same as EryF1, NF-E1, EF-1, EF gamma-a, GF1), expressed in RBC, mast cell, megakaryocyte, hematopoietic progenitor cell, testis. GATA1 is associated with a special class of nuclear bodies, activated by erythropoietin, inactivated by coactivation of DEATH receptors (TNFRSF6) mediated caspase cleavage.

ZBTB16 (Zinc finger and BTB domain-containing protein 16) is a zinc finger transcription factor. It is a member of the Krueppel C2H2-type zinc-finger protein family, containing nine Kruppel-type zinc finger domains at the carboxyl terminus. This protein is located in the nucleus, is involved in cell cycle progression and interacts with a histone deacetylase. Specific instances of aberrant gene rearrangement at this locus have been associated with acute promyelocytic leukemia (APL). Alternate transcriptional splice variants have been characterized.

MECT1 (MucoEpidermoid Carcinoma Translocated 1) is a transcriptional coactivator for CREB1. CREB1 activates transcription through both consensus and variant cAMP response element (CRE) sites. MECT1 does not appear to modulate CREB1 DNA-binding activity but enhances the interaction of CREB1 with TAF4/TAFII-130. MECT1 translocates with MAML2 (MasterMind-Like Protein 2) to yield a fusion oncogene: t(11;19) (q21;p13). This translocation occurs in mucoepidermoid carcinomas, benign Warthin tumors and clear cell hidradenomas.

STAT5 (Signal transducer and activator of transcription 5A) carries out a dual function: signal transduction and activation of transcription. STAT5 is tyrosine phosphorylated in response to IL-2, IL-3, IL-7, IL-15, GM-CSF, growth hormone, prolactin, erythropoietin and thrombopoietin. Phosphorylation results in translocation into the nucleus, where it binds to the GAS element and activates transcription. Tyrosine phosphorylation is required for DNA-binding activity and dimerization. Serine phosphorylation is also required for maximal transcriptional activity.
